The aim of the study is efficacy and potential benefits of cyclodextrins in delivering fragrances with and without CDs were compared using headspace/solid-phase microextraction gas chromatog. All measurements and assessments were carried out on the volar forearms(s) of one Caucasian subject in a controlled environment: 25 ± 1°C and 30% ± 5% relative humidity. GC test protocol: The GC test protocol included: 1) washing the subject′s forearm three times with ethanol and allowing it to air-dry: 2) spraying 200 mg of a test EdT three times and allowing it to air-dry for 2 min; 3) a 20-min stabilization phase: 4) a 20-min extraction phase; 5) a 2-min desorption phase; and 6) CO-MS anal. To trap gas, a glass bell jar (105 cm3) was used, along with a syringe incorporating an SPME fiber in polydimethylsiloxane (PDMS), to absorb volatile compounds Olfactory test: The olfactory test procedure involved washing both of the subject′s forearms three times with ethanol and allowing them to air-dry, then spraying -200 mg of a test EdT three times and allowing it to air-dry for 2 min. Twenty perfume experts then smelled the two forearms to make assessments. Measurements and assessments were performed every- three hours to determine the perfume evolution on skin. Results from the headspace/SPME-GC anal. indicated that initially (T0), the fragrance samples with and without CD had the same perfume intensity. Three hours later, however (T+3 h), the CD-containing perfume was approx. 50% more intense than the perfume without CD.

Imines or Schiff bases (SB) are formed by the condensation of an aldehyde or a ketone with a primary amine, with the removal of a water mol. Schiff bases are central mols. in several biol. processes for their ability to form and cleave by small variation of the medium. We report here the controlled hydrolysis of four SBs that may be applied in the fragrance industry, as they are profragrances all containing odorant mols.: Me anthranilate as primary amine, and four aldehydes (cyclamal, helional, hydroxycitronellal and triplal) that are very volatile odorants. The SB stability was assessed over time by HPLC-MS in neutral or acidic conditions, both in solution and when trapped in low mol. weight gels. Our results demonstrate that it is possible to control the hydrolysis of the Schiff bases in the gel environment, thus tuning the quantity of aldehyde released and the persistency of the fragrance.

In this work, the vapor-liquid equilibrium of binary and multinary systems comprise perfume raw materials and ionic liquids have been computed using two different models: COSMO-RS, a solvation model, and UNIFAC, a group contribution method. For systems already well-known in the literature, a comparison with exptl. data was performed, and good agreement was observed with both models. Although UNIFAC was not applicable to nonparametrized ionic liquids, COSMO-RS proved very reliable in predicting the vapor-liquid equilibrium of solutions of perfume raw materials in new-to-the-world ionic liquids This opens the door for the prediction and modeling of new formulations for novel consumer products, prior to embarking on detailed exptl. investigations.

Composition of a series of formulations used in Russia for production of various perfumes, among them car air fresheners, was studied by 13C and 1H NMR. The main components were identified, approx. compositions of several perfumes were determined, and spectral data are given. These spectral data can be used for prompt anal. for composition of com. odorants with the aim of monitoring their quality and hygienic characteristics.

Meta-anal. of In the United States, cancer is the second leading cause of mortality, and millions more battle cancer worldwide. As such, primary prevention of cancer is a major interest globally. Aspirin has been studied as a primary prevention method for multiple diseases, mainly cardiovascular disease and various forms of cancer. The role of aspirin as a primary prevention of cancer is still controversial and may be more beneficial in certain cancers over others. With rapidly surfacing large randomized controlled trials (RCTs) studying this subject, we aimed to evaluate the efficacy and safety of aspirin as a primary prophylaxis for cancer. A comprehensive electronic database search was conducted for all RCTs that compared aspirin vs. placebo for the prevention of any type of disease, and where cancer incidence or mortality was reported. The primary outcome was cancer related mortality. Secondary outcomes were cancer incidence, all-cause mortality, major bleeding, any bleeding and gastrointestinal (GI) bleeding. We calculated risk ratios (RRs) and 95% confidence intervals (CIs) using a random-effects model at the longest follow-up period. We included 16 RCTs with 104,018 total patients, mean age of 60.51 years, mean follow-up of 5.48 years, and a male percentage of 38.72%. We found that aspirin was not associated with a significant reduction of cancer-related mortality compared with placebo (RR 0.99; 95% CI: 0.87-1.12; P = 0.85: I2 = 41%). Compared with placebo, aspirin was not associated with significant reduction of all-cause mortality (RR 0.97; 95% CI: 0.92-1.02; P = 0.19; I2 = 13%) or cancer incidence (RR: 0.98; 95% CI: 0.92-1.04; P = 0.43; I2 = 16%). However, aspirin treatment was associated with significantly increased risks of any bleeding (RR 1.63; 95% CI: 1.31-2.03; P < 0.01), major bleeding (RR 1.41; 95% CI: 1.26-1.57; P < 0.01), and GI bleeding (RR 1.85; 95% CI: 1.38-2.48; P < 0.01) compared with placebo. Our study did not find any significant reductions in cancer-related mortality or cancer incidence when compared aspirin use with placebo or no aspirin. Our study also highlights that the use of aspirin for primary prevention of cancer was found to cause higher rates of bleeding (any bleeding, major bleeding, and GI bleeding) compared to placebo or no aspirin at the longest follow-up period with no significant benefit in cancer primary prevention. A photocatalytic approach for carbon isotope exchange is reported. Utilizing [13C]CO2 and [14C]CO2 as primary C1 sources, this protocol allows the insertion of the desired carbon isotope into Ph acetic acids without the need for structural modifications or prefunctionalization in one single step. The exceptionally mild conditions required for this traceless transformation are in stark contrast with those for previous methods requiring the use of harsh thermal conditions.

Aroma profiles and aroma-active compounds of Sichuan vinegar, which is one of the four famous vinegars in China, were systemically analyzed by solvent-assisted flavor evaporation-gas chromatog.-mass spectrometry (SAFE-GC-MS) and gas chromatog.-olfactometry (GC-O). In addition, descriptive profile anal., aroma reconstitution, and omission test were used to evaluate and compare the Sichuan modern vinegar (SMV) and Sichuan traditional vinegar (STV). A total of 99 volatile compounds were tentatively identified from the neutral and acidic fractions of both samples. Among them, 77 compounds were pos. identified after comparison with their corresponding standards Forty-two aroma-active compounds were characterized with flavor dilution (FD) factors from 1 to 6561 by aroma extract dilution assay (AEDA)-GC-O, with the highest for 2-hydroxy-3-butanone, butyrolactone, furan-2-carbaldehyde, acetic acid, and 3-oxobutan-2-yl acetate in both STV and SMV samples. Among them, 10 were identified for the first time in vinegar. Moreover, 40 aroma-active compounds were quant. determined, and 26 compounds exhibited their odor activity values (OAVs) larger than 1. The reconstituted solutions showed similar aroma profiles to the original samples in their characteristic aromas in terms of fruity, sweet, roasty, spicy, and woody notes but had slight differences in nutty and herbal notes.

A new method for the synthesis of chiral diene Rh catalysts is introduced. The readily available racemic tetrafluorobenzobarrelene complexes [(R2-TFB)RhCl]2 were separated into two enantiomers via selective coordination of one of them with the auxiliary S-salicyl-oxazoline ligand. One of the resulting chiral complexes with an exceptionally bulky diene ligand [(R,R-iPr2-TFB)RhCl]2 was an efficient catalyst for the asym. insertion of diazoesters into B-H and Si-H bonds giving the functionalized organoboranes and silanes with high yields (79-97%) and enantiomeric purity (87-98% ee). The stereoselectivity of separation via auxiliary ligand and that of the catalytic reaction was predicted by DFT calculations

The unique structure of oxyallyls represents a significant challenge for their catalytic asym. applications. Herein, an unprecedented chiral imidodiphosphoric acid-catalytic enantioselective (3 + 3) cycloaddition between oxyallyl zwitterions generated in situ from α-haloketones and α-diazomethylphosphonates was developed. Pharmaceutically interesting chiral pyridazine-4(1H)-ones were obtained in up to 98% yields with excellent stereoselectivities (up to 99% ee, > 99:1 dr).

A protocol of [3 + 3]-cycloaddition was proposed for the synthesis of 2H-1,4-thiazin-3(4H)-ones I (R = Me, Et, Bn; Ar = C6H5, 3-ClC6H4, 4-CNC6H4, 1-naphthyl, etc.) and thiomorpholine-3,5-diones II from α-chlorohydroxamates ArCH(Cl)C(O)NHOR and 1,4-dithiane-2,5-diol. This direct and practical method provides a novel and rapid approach for the synthesis of thiomorpholin-3-one derivatives II under mild condition with moderate to good yield and wide functional group tolerance.
